Introducing Slack and Google Slides
Slack, Microsoft Teams, Yammer, etc., belong to a category of solutions that help Team Collaboration, whereas Google Slides, Microsoft PowerPoint, Keynote, etc., belong to a category of solutions that help Presentation Software. Different products excel in different areas, so the best platform for your business will depend on your specific needs and requirements.
Slack covers Collaboration with Chat, Communication Management with Chat, Content Management with Chat, Sales Document Management with Chat, etc.
Google Slides focuses on Collaboration, Sales Document Management, Content Management, Engagement Management, etc.
